Shell admits climate policy threat to profits

Will Nichols
clock

Oil major's 2013 Strategic Report highlights company will face project delays and higher costs unless it can reduce emissions

Perhaps fossil fuel companies are catching on to the climate change message after all. Oil giant Shell has this week followed its decision to shelve its plans to drill in the Arctic for one year by acknowledging...
